3rd of Winter 517 A.V.
Aliana woke up with a stretch popping her neck. She was happy to have a quiet day while Holley came by to watch Larissa. The mother wanted to go see what was happening within the city before bringing her little one out into it. Morwen had not come back at the season change this year, and it made the girl nervous. Standing up, the dark haired woman popped her neck while getting everything ready for a bath. Slipping down into the water with a sigh, she was glad to relax in the warm liquid that covered her from her neck all the way down. After half a bell of soaking, the woman sat up and finished her bath for the day. Getting out, she got dried off and walked to her closet. The girl had to get more clothes, most of what she presently had smelled of forged iron and had soot in it.
“It's going to be another hot one,” Aliana said quietly and grabbed her tank top and pants.
She got dress and put her shoes in her bag. The woman wanted to just go without shoes unless the stone would be too hot. The girl kissed her daughter on the forehead while Holley held the child on her hip. Saying good bye while leaving Ink with the child and baby sitter, the woman walked out closing the door. She smiled hearing it lock behind her meaning the group was secure. Popping her neck some, she walked down the stairs and saw that the front door to the lobby was left wide open. The heat coming in from outside did not surprise her in the least. The young Isur wished more than anything that she could talk to her patron god about what was going on with Morwen. The girl doubted he would answer her truthfully if at all, but at least she could say that she gave it a try.
“Oh well. Hm a trip to the gardens would be nice,” Aliana whispered.
She walked around while looking for some kind of sign or listening for a name. Looking up at the sky, the girl was glad that it was still very early in the morning. Coughing some, she walked across the cobblestone pathway. The rocks were still cool not yet heated by the sun's rays. Looking around the city, the dark haired woman was not very sociable but saw several places that caused some interest. Making plans to come back later it did not take long at a steady pace for her to find a luscious thriving park. Walking inside, the girl looked around and finally spotted the name of the area.
“Semele Park?” Aliana stated almost in a question like manor.
The girl ventured inside and looked around loving the beauty and quietness of the area. She was not a people person; so the few and far between person walking the park put her at ease. The dark haired woman finally stopped and sat down as the sun got higher in the sky. She opened her bag before putting her shoes on before it the stones got any hotter on the soles of her feet. The woman heard the strange sound of chains before noticing a shadow approaching where she was sitting.
